BCA Friends: Family Ties Private Viewing

Thursday, March 8, 2018 6:00 PM 8:30 PM

Friends of Black Cultural Archives are invited to a special evening viewing of the insightful and spiritually powerful exhibition, Family Ties – The Adamah Papers. The forthcoming exhibition will present personal narrative of a British-Ghanaian family and their discovery of a deeply rooted family history that had a global impact.

BCA Friends enjoy the opportunity to meet the curator as she shares her personal curatorial journey in presenting the voices of the Ewe people of Ghana, the traditions, customs and the historical colonial relationship to the Empire.
